In order to find the weight of the steel rod, we must know is mass and volume.Volume of a cylinder:Pi x r2 x lengthpi x (0.00514)2 x 1Volume = 8.3x10-5 m3Steel has a density of 7850 kg/m3Therefore the mass of the steel rod = 7850 x 8.3x10-5 = 0.652 kgWeight of rod = 0.652 x 9.81Weight of rod = 6.39 Newtons
